Como Funciona uma Blockchain

O Que é uma Blockchain?

Blockchain é uma tecnologia revolucionária que sustenta a maioria das criptomoedas, incluindo o Bitcoin, e tem aplicações que vão muito além das finanças. Para entender como uma blockchain funciona, precisamos decompor o conceito e examinar seus componentes e operações.

1. Estrutura Básica da Blockchain

Uma blockchain é essencialmente uma cadeia de blocos de dados, onde cada bloco contém um conjunto de transações. Esses blocos estão encadeados de forma linear, com cada novo bloco contendo um hash do bloco anterior. Este hash é uma representação digital única do conteúdo do bloco anterior.

  • Bloco: Cada bloco na cadeia contém um número de transações, um carimbo de data/hora e um hash do bloco anterior.
  • Hash: Um hash é um código gerado por uma função matemática que representa o conteúdo do bloco. Se o conteúdo do bloco mudar, o hash também muda, garantindo a integridade dos dados.
  • Transação: As transações são os registros de ações (como transferências de criptomoedas) que são adicionadas aos blocos.

2. Funcionamento do Processo

Quando uma transação é feita, ela é agrupada com outras transações em um bloco. Este bloco é então validado pelos participantes da rede, conhecidos como nós.

  • Validação: Os nós verificam se as transações dentro do bloco são válidas, usando algoritmos de consenso (como Proof of Work ou Proof of Stake).
  • Criação de Bloco: Uma vez validado, o bloco é adicionado à cadeia e distribuído por toda a rede. Cada nó atualiza sua própria cópia da blockchain.

3. Consenso e Segurança

A segurança e a integridade da blockchain são garantidas por mecanismos de consenso. Estes mecanismos garantem que todos os nós na rede concordem com o estado atual da blockchain.

  • Proof of Work (PoW): Um algoritmo onde os participantes resolvem problemas matemáticos complexos para validar blocos. É usado em Bitcoin e outras criptomoedas.
  • Proof of Stake (PoS): Um algoritmo onde a validação de blocos é baseada na quantidade de criptomoeda que um participante possui e está disposto a "apostar" como garantia.

4. Vantagens da Blockchain

A tecnologia blockchain oferece várias vantagens significativas:

  • Descentralização: Em vez de depender de uma entidade central, a blockchain distribui a autoridade entre todos os participantes da rede.
  • Transparência: Todas as transações são visíveis e verificáveis por todos os participantes da rede.
  • Imutabilidade: Uma vez que um bloco é adicionado à blockchain, ele não pode ser alterado sem modificar todos os blocos seguintes, o que é praticamente impossível.

5. Aplicações da Blockchain

Além das criptomoedas, a tecnologia blockchain tem diversas aplicações:

  • Contratos Inteligentes: Programas que executam automaticamente as condições de um contrato quando determinadas condições são atendidas.
  • Supply Chain: Rastreamento de produtos ao longo de toda a cadeia de suprimentos para garantir autenticidade e qualidade.
  • Votação: Sistemas de votação baseados em blockchain podem oferecer maior segurança e transparência nas eleições.

6. Desafios e Limitações

Apesar das vantagens, a blockchain enfrenta vários desafios:

  • Escalabilidade: A capacidade de processar um grande número de transações por segundo ainda é limitada em muitas blockchains.
  • Custo: O processo de mineração (no caso de PoW) pode ser muito caro em termos de energia e recursos.
  • Regulação: A falta de regulamentação clara pode criar incertezas e riscos para os usuários e investidores.

7. O Futuro da Blockchain

O futuro da blockchain é promissor, com muitas inovações em andamento:

  • Integração com IA: A combinação de blockchain com inteligência artificial pode criar sistemas mais eficientes e inteligentes.
  • Interoperabilidade: Desenvolvimento de soluções para permitir que diferentes blockchains se comuniquem e compartilhem dados.
  • Sustentabilidade: Avanços na tecnologia para reduzir o impacto ambiental da mineração de criptomoedas.

8. Conclusão

Blockchain é uma tecnologia poderosa que tem o potencial de transformar várias indústrias, desde finanças até logística e além. À medida que a tecnologia continua a evoluir, seu impacto na sociedade e na economia global provavelmente se expandirá.

Comentários Populares
    Sem Comentários no Momento
Comentário

0